Analyzing Recent Performances

So, you've found out who's starting. Now what? It's time to dig a little deeper and analyze their recent performances. This is where it gets interesting, guys. First, look at their ERA (Earned Run Average). This tells you how many earned runs the pitcher has allowed per nine innings. A lower ERA is always better. Then check their WHIP (Walks plus Hits per Inning Pitched). This shows how many baserunners they allow per inning pitched. A lower WHIP is also better, as it indicates the pitcher is good at keeping runners off base. Also, consider their strikeout rate. Do they strike out a lot of batters? A high strikeout rate is a good sign that they're dominating. Additionally, look at their recent game logs. How have they performed in their last few starts? Are they on a hot streak, or have they been struggling? Check their last 5-10 starts to get a sense of their consistency. It's a great idea to check the opposing team's stats. How well does the opposing team hit against right-handed or left-handed pitchers? Does the pitcher have a good track record against the opposing team?

Also, consider the pitcher's velocity. Is their fastball as fast as usual? Any drop in velocity could indicate fatigue or injury. Besides that, you need to understand the pitcher's pitch mix. Does he rely more on fastballs, curveballs, or sliders? Knowing this can give you insight into their strategy and how the opposing team might prepare. One of the most important things to examine is the pitcher's control. How many walks do they give up? A pitcher who walks a lot of batters is more likely to give up runs. Finally, don't forget the home/away splits. Do they perform better at home or on the road? The environment can significantly affect their performance. All of this can provide an idea of the pitcher's form and their likelihood of performing well. The better the form, the more likely the Dodgers will have a great start.

Key Stats and Metrics to Consider

To understand the Dodgers' starting pitcher, you need to know some key stats and metrics that will give you a clear view of their performance. First, the ERA, or Earned Run Average, is a fundamental metric. It represents the average number of earned runs a pitcher allows per nine innings. A lower ERA means the pitcher is more effective at preventing runs. Next, WHIP (Walks plus Hits per Inning Pitched) is another important metric. WHIP shows the number of base runners a pitcher allows per inning pitched. A lower WHIP signifies the pitcher's effectiveness at keeping batters off base. Another thing is the strikeout rate, the percentage of batters the pitcher strikes out. A high strikeout rate indicates the pitcher's ability to dominate batters and is an important sign of a pitcher's effectiveness.

The K/BB ratio is also very important, because it highlights the balance between strikeouts and walks. A high K/BB ratio shows the pitcher strikes out a lot of batters while giving up few walks. It is a sign of a pitcher's control and ability to avoid baserunners. In addition, you must examine the pitcher's pitch velocity, the speed of their pitches, especially the fastball. A drop in velocity might indicate fatigue or injury. So, look at the speed when compared to their previous games. Besides all these stats, you have to also consider the recent game logs, checking their performances in the last 5-10 starts. It helps in identifying any trends. Look at the pitcher's consistency, and this will tell you about their form. When assessing performance, be sure to also check the pitcher's statistics against the opposing team. This will reveal if the pitcher has a history of success or struggle.

Factors Affecting a Pitcher's Performance

There's a lot more that goes into a pitcher's performance than just their raw stats. Here are some things to think about. First, the opposing team's lineup matters. Does the opposing team have a lot of left-handed hitters if your pitcher struggles against lefties? Secondly, think about the stadium conditions. Is it a hitter-friendly park, or is the wind blowing in? The weather can significantly impact a pitcher's performance. Also, be aware of injury and fatigue. Is the pitcher coming off an injury? Are they throwing on short rest? Also, consider the mental game. Is the pitcher confident and focused? Pressure can affect performance. Additionally, you should be checking the pitcher's history against the opposing team. Does the pitcher have a good track record against them? Or, do they tend to struggle against certain hitters?

Also, you need to know the quality of the defense behind the pitcher. Are there any defensive shifts planned? Good defense can save a pitcher runs. Plus, you need to evaluate the umpire's strike zone. A generous strike zone can favor the pitcher. Also, consider any pre-game rituals. Does the pitcher have any routines? These routines can help them get in the right mindset. One thing that matters is the pitcher's preparation. Are they coming from a long layoff, or are they well-rested? Lastly, evaluate the game situation. Is it a high-pressure game? Does the pitcher perform better under pressure? All of these can affect how the pitcher performs. So, if you consider these factors, it will give you a deeper understanding of the game and how the pitcher's performance may look.
